If you are not going to use the built-in monitor speakers then you could probably use a DVI cable for the PC instead of a second HDMI (if you already do not have an additional one).
 
some things to consider

if you use HDMI for both you can then use your heaphone jack on your monitor to provide sound input to your speakers. (I am assuming that your monitor has a headphone jack)

To get audio from the PS3 to your speakers you will have to use AV cable with a RCA to 3.5mm stereo mini plug adapter or optical out from the PS3 or pass the audio from the monitor to your speakers as mentioned above. Do your speakers support optical in? a lot of them do.

to connect your PC to your speakers you can do it as you currently are or as mentioned above run cable from headphone jackl to speaker input, or use SPDIF

on a side note PS3 optical supports up to 5.1, anything higher and it will be down-mixed. PS3 also does not have a headpone jack nor does it have a coax SPDIF
